Recently, a new bearing was installed in a motor at the company less than two days ago, and it had to be removed for inspection due to abnormal noises. Upon disassembly, it was found that there was a steel ball inside the bearing with severely damaged surface. I don’t know what the reason is? Why are the other steel balls fine, while only one is damaged?

There can be various reasons for damage to bearing balls. If only the surface of one ball is damaged while the other balls remain intact, this situation may be caused by the following factors: 1. **Foreign object intrusion**: Small foreign objects may enter the bearing during installation, resulting in continuous impact or wear on a single ball. 2. **Installation issues**: If the bearings are not installed with sufficient precision, it may lead to uneven distribution of forces within the bearings, causing one of the steel balls to bear an abnormal load and get damaged. 3. **Insufficient lubrication**: If the bearings are not adequately lubricated at the beginning of operation, it may lead to localized overheating or overload, causing damage to individual steel balls. 4. **Manufacturing defects**: Although relatively rare, it cannot be ruled out that the steel balls themselves may have minor defects, which can expand rapidly under load and lead to damage. 5. **Excessive bearing preload**: If the bearing preload is set too high, it can also cause the individual steel balls to bear an excessive load and get damaged. The key to solving such problems is to carefully examine the installation process, the fit between the bearings and the shaft, as well as the lubrication conditions. Ensure cleanliness during installation, follow the correct installation procedures, adjust the appropriate preload, and maintain good lubrication conditions. For the inspection and maintenance of bearings, it is also very important to regularly monitor their operating condition. .
